Хэдли Уикхэм (Hadley Wickham) демистифицирует архитектуру современных ИИ-агентов для программирования, таких как Claude Code, Cursor и Codex. Вместо «магического» интеллекта он описывает их как системы-оболочки (harness), работающие за счет оркестрации набора базовых инструментов.

Что произошло
В своей статье Хэдли Уикхэм утверждает, что современные coding-агенты представляют собой не монолитные модели, а системы управления, оснащенные шестью ключевыми инструментами: чтением, записью, редактированием, листингом файлов, поиском и выполнением команд в shell. Особое внимание уделяется механизму точечного редактирования (targeted edit), который позволяет вносить изменения в конкретные фрагменты кода вместо полной перезаписи файлов.
Контекст
Разработка ИИ-инструментов традиционно фокусировалась на улучшении способностей LLM к генерации кода. Однако текущая архитектура агентов смещает фокус на оптимизацию взаимодействия модели с окружением через эффективное использование инструментов (tool-use efficiency) и проектирование надежных harness-систем.
Почему это важно для индустрии
Для отрасли это означает переход от создания простых «оберток» над моделями к проектированию сложных систем управления. Критическим аспектом становится оптимизация механизмов взаимодействия: использование точечного редактирования (targeted edit) напрямую повышает экономическую эффективность за счет снижения расхода токенов и улучшает безопасность, минимизируя риск внесения ошибок в нерелевантные части кода.
Почему это важно для пользователей
Понимание того, что агент — это набор инструментов, а не «черный ящик», позволяет разработчикам более осознанно подходить к созданию собственных agentic workflows. Это смещает фокус с бесконечного промпт-инжиниринга на оптимизацию конкретных инструментов и механизмов управления системой.
Что пока неизвестно / ограничения
Прямых технических разногласий по архитектурному составу инструментов не выявлено.
Источники
Автор
Look at AI, редакция
